| P1589 | Acceleration Sensor Learning Value |
DESCRIPTION
The ECM stores DTC P1589 if the Deceleration Sensor Zero Point Calibration is not performed or failed after system components such as the ECM are replaced.

PROCEDURE
PERFORM INITIALIZATION (DECELERATION SENSOR ZERO POINT CALIBRATION)
Note
If CVT Oil Pressure Calibration is performed before Deceleration Sensor Zero Point Calibration, DTC P1589 is stored. In this case, perform steps *1, *2, *3, *4 and *5 to return the system to normal.
Always perform calibration with the vehicle on level ground (Inclination: 0 +/-0.25°).
Do not shake or vibrate the vehicle during calibration.
Turn the ignition switch off.*1
Move the shift lever to P and apply the parking brake.*2
Connect the GTS to the DLC3.
Turn the ignition switch to ON.*3
Note
Do not start the engine.
Enter the following menus: Powertrain / Engine and ECT / Utility / Reset Memory.*4
Enter the following menus: Powertrain / Engine and ECT / Utility / Deceleration Sensor Zero Point Calibration.*5
Tech Tips
When "Complete" is displayed on the screen, Deceleration Sensor Zero Point Calibration is complete.
If "Error" is displayed on the screen, the yaw rate sensor circuit may be malfunctioning.
Shaking or vibrating the vehicle during Deceleration Sensor Zero Point Calibration may cancel calibration. If "Error" is displayed on the screen, perform step *5 again.
If "Error" is displayed on the GTS, read the DTCs using the GTS.

PERFORM CVT OIL PRESSURE CALIBRATION
Note
Do not clear the learned values by performing Reset Memory.
Turn the ignition switch off and wait at least 30 seconds.
Connect the GTS to the DLC3.
Turn the ignition switch to ON and wait at least 2 seconds.
Note
Do not start the engine.
Tech Tips
CVT Oil Pressure Calibration is performed with the ignition switch ON (engine stopped). However, calibration cannot be performed under the following conditions:
Oil pressure sensor value is 0.065 MPa (0.663 kgf/cm2, 9.43 psi) or higher.
CVT oil temperature is 0°C (32°F) or less or 120°C (248°F) or higher.
Enter the following menus: Powertrain / Engine and ECT / Utility.
Start the engine and wait at least 5 seconds.
Note
Start the engine with the shift lever in P.
After starting the engine, do not operate the accelerator pedal.
Enter the following menus: Powertrain / Engine and ECT / Utility / CVT Oil Pressure Calibration.
Tech Tips
During CVT Oil Pressure Calibration, the engine idle speed will increase.
When "Complete" is displayed on the screen, CVT Oil Pressure Calibration is complete.
The learned values cannot be cleared by only disconnecting and reconnecting the cable to the negative (-) battery terminal.
